It Is with profound sadness that the family of Maria Teresa Bautista, known to friends and family as Tess, announces her passing after an illness, on Monday, May 18, 2020 at the age of 59. She is survived by her 20-year old daughter, Jade. Tess will be forever remembered by her brothers and sisters, Jess, Cesar, Sherri, Priscilla, Connie, Stephanie, sisters-in-law Evelyn and Alice, brothers-in-law Robert Wolf, Jimmy Chua and Mark Oligan, and stepmother Evelyn. Tess was predeceased by her parents Braulio and Rosario Bautista and her brother Franklin. Loving memories of Tess will also not be forgotten by her numerous nieces, nephews, aunts, uncles, friends and co-workers.
Since childhood, Tess lived a simple life, yet full of joyful memories with family and friends in San Jose City, Nueva Ecija, Philippines. She was a very sweet, thoughtful and loving sister. Per her younger sister Connie, she was also a mentor, a playmate, and a & a "buddy." They grew up together and went to the same school In both Elementary and HIgh School. Tess was an inspiration! She did very well in school as well as in her job. She was tagged as a perfectionist, but to those who knew her well, she was a passionate and committed human being.In college. She went to Polytechnic University of the Philippines and became a Certified Public Accountant.
When she migrated to United States, she attended Chabot College in Hayward, CA and became a Registered Nurse (RN). She devoted 24 years of her nursing career at Zuckerberg SanFrancisco General Hospital in San Francisco, CA. She was also a CPR-Basic Life Support Instructor at Providence Vocational School in Daly City, CA.
Tess will be remembered as a loving mother to her dearest Jade. She was a generous provider who never demanded anything in return for all the help and support she extended not only to her family and friends but to less fortunate people. When she was diagnosed with Cancer, she never complained rather, she faced her destiny with hope and courage. In pain and suffering, she committed and surrendered her life into the Mighty Hands of our God, the Father through the saving grace of His Son, Jesus Christ.
